Actually I respectfully disagree, everything he did in this video is well within his normal repertoir and game. Hes been doing this since he was 16/17 on a pro level in Germany, Australia etc. For him the thing is confidence, playing time and chemistry with his PGs. Hes good, not 20/10 good but hes serviceable on an NBA level as a 2nd, 3rd big off the bench... his "problem" is that the Knicks have probably the best 1-2 punch a C with KAT and Mitch...

Piggybacking my response to you in the game thread, I think the FO has been really good at drafting overlooked talent and bringing them along. It seems they did replace Thibs with another coach in part to have deeper rotations this year to get extra playing time for the developing players. This is key for a FO that may need to move a max or near max player at some point and they want affordable depth in the pipeline for that reason among others. Diawara is a prime example. I strongly doubt he'd have gotten much opportunity under Thibs this year like Brown has given Mo. Small differences in management style accrue over time. Per Huk, he may be in the mix next year along with Mo and that would be due to the FO's vision for sure. Sometimes you have to give players time on the court to "get ready" so to speak and not just practice sessions and G League minutes. That means allowing for mistakes, but also giving them a taste of the speed of the NBA game so they can internalize that into their own maturation process. I think mostly Brown has done that in appropriate doses for a guy like Diawara even if I'm not particularly stoked about Kolek riding the bench for Jose at the moment. |
